Aistinguid is an Estonian noun that refers to sensory modalities or perceptions collectively. The term derives from aisting, meaning sense or perception, with the plural form aistinguid used when speaking of multiple senses or perceptual inputs. In standard Estonian grammar, aistinguid appears in the accusative or partitive case depending on the sentence, and is often encountered in academic writing on perception, neurology, and psychology.
